构建和测试无障碍网页应用

Build & Test Accessible Web Apps

 用于交付高质量 Web 应用程序的全面辅助功能培训

一个自定进度的研讨会,旨在向您介绍从设计到部署的辅助功能原则和有效模式。

如果您的应用程序无法为残障人士使用,则您的工作尚未完成。

您有责任为尽可能多的用户提供符合预期工作的高质量应用程序。

没有可以挥动和创建可访问应用程序的魔杖。

没有单一的工具可以消除这些挑战。

要构建可访问的应用程序,您的团队需要优先考虑可访问性。

最重要的是,您的团队需要转变可访问性的思维方式。

无障碍思维方式的转变

确保您的应用程序可访问需要转变思维方式 — 不仅对于作为开发人员的您,而且对于您的设计人员和组织中的利益相关者也是如此。

这些领域中的每一个都带来了自己的一系列挑战:

  • 我应该如何确定应用程序功能的优先级?

  • 我能做些什么来确保我的解决方案对残障人士有效?

  • 我如何获得我的团队的支持?

  • 我该如何解决我甚至不知道自己存在的辅助功能问题?

这些问题通常需要多年来之不易的经验才能回答,如果您刚刚开始,则更难回答。

需要在业务的技术技能和人际交往技能方面开展工作,以便向用户提供可访问的特性和功能。

在 Web 辅助功能的每个领域进行规划和执行

  • 构建您的辅助功能基础
    学习常用词汇
    了解辅助功能的商业案例
  • 培养无障碍的组织文化
    在编写代码行之前识别潜在问题
    实现专注的跨团队协作
  • 识别 Web 应用程序中的问题
    使用行业标准工具
    使非开发人员能够识别辅助功能问题
  • 从一开始就的最佳实践
    开发完全支持辅助技术的复杂交互
    实施自动化测试,防止问题被部署

 

可重复、定义明确的辅助功能测试流程

通过有效的手动和自动测试计划,获得利益相关者和同事的可访问性支持。

确定应用程序中最高价值的用户流。

记录完成流程的 “仅鼠标” 和 “仅键盘” 说明,并补充基于浏览器的辅助功能工具的预期输出。

为用户流中涉及的每个交互式控件编写有针对性的单元测试,以确保它们符合行业标准的辅助功能准则。

模拟用户通过集成测试完成最重要的流程。

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。